**Holiday Opening Hours — Visiting Contractors**

During the Midwinter closure, the Bramleigh Works site operates reduced hours: the main entrance is staffed 08:00–14:00, and the loading dock closes entirely. Contractors for Tessoria Ltd must sign in at the east lobby only. After 14:00, access is via the side turnstile, which requires the temporary pass code below.

door code, yagap-bahof: bdg-O-05

CI kept failing on the Larkspur pipeline's zero-downtime migration stage. Root cause: the expand-contract check in our Tollgate runner compares the new schema against the replica, not the primary, and the replica hadn't applied the additive columns yet. I added a readiness gate that polls replication state before the contract phase runs, and reran the full suite twice to confirm stability. Nothing destructive executed at any point; the old code path stayed compatible throughout. The passing run emitted the trace token below.

build token for kagaf-hahof: htk14_9d3d4d26d7d8de

## Service Accounts: Cron Migration to Flowline

As of this quarter, all legacy cron jobs on the batch hosts are being moved to Flowline, our internal workflow engine. New team members should not add crontab entries; instead, define a Flowline DAG and assign it to the `svc-batch-runner` service account. That account has read access to the artifact store and write access to the results bucket. Each DAG authenticates to the Flowline scheduler API using the key below.

gateway credential: kto7_GoY89Me

Ticket DRIFT-212: parity gap between the Lumenkit JS and Kotlin SDKs. Heads up for folks new to the team — the two SDKs are supposed to read identical flag payloads from Corvid, but the Kotlin side picked up a retry knob last sprint that JS never got, and now staging behaves differently depending on platform. Classic config drift. We need to reconcile before the Marlow release, otherwise mobile users get stale variants. To see exactly where they diverge, compare against the canonical values below.

service settings:
PRAWYN_PIN=9848
PRAWYN_METRICS_HOST=metrics.prawyn.lumicworks.corp
PRAWYN_LOG_LEVEL=warn
PRAWYN_TENANT=pelius